Shivajinagar Population - Haveri, Karnataka

Shivajinagar is a medium size village located in Hangal Taluka of Haveri district, Karnataka with total 267 families residing. The Shivajinagar village has population of 1353 of which 711 are males while 642 are females as per Population Census 2011.

In Shivajinagar village population of children with age 0-6 is 184 which makes up 13.60 % of total population of village. Average Sex Ratio of Shivajinagar village is 903 which is lower than Karnataka state average of 973. Child Sex Ratio for the Shivajinagar as per census is 1067, higher than Karnataka average of 948.

Shivajinagar village has higher literacy rate compared to Karnataka. In 2011, literacy rate of Shivajinagar village was 79.21 % compared to 75.36 % of Karnataka. In Shivajinagar Male literacy stands at 88.26 % while female literacy rate was 68.92 %.

Caste Factor

Schedule Caste (SC) constitutes 0.96 % while Schedule Tribe (ST) were 0.44 % of total population in Shivajinagar village.

Work Profile

In Shivajinagar village out of total population, 842 were engaged in work activities. 49.76 % of workers describe their work as Main Work (Employment or Earning more than 6 Months) while 50.24 % were involved in Marginal activity providing livelihood for less than 6 months. Of 842 workers engaged in Main Work, 319 were cultivators (owner or co-owner) while 78 were Agricultural labourer.
